Bensalem People Are More Generous Than Those in Feasterville-Trevose

Taxpayers living in the 19020 zip code gave more to charity than their neighbors in the 19053 zip code.

 

Bensalem taxpayers gave 3.6 percent of their income to charity, according to data compiled by The Chronicle of Philanthopy.” 

Based on tax records from the IRS for 2008 – the most recent year for which such data are available – Bensalem residents in the 19020 zip code gave a median contribution of $1,822 to charity on a disposable income of $50,911. In total, Bensalem taxpayers donated $16.4 million.

That’s slightly higher than their neighbors in the Feasterville-Trevose 19053 zip code who gave 3.3 percent or $1,775 on an income of $54,237. In total, Feasterville-Trevose taxpayers donated $11 million.

Out of 28,725 zip codes measured, 19020 ranked 18,485 and 19053 ranked 20,523. By comparison, the median contribution in Pennsylvania was 3.9 percent and 4.7 percent for the entire United States.

The data comes from a special report, “How America Gives,” that examines by zip code and by income. The study is based on the exact dollar amount of charitable deductions made by American taxpayers on their tax returns.
